Welcome to the vibrant world of E-Dragon Dumplings Bar, located at 2 Defries Ave, Zetland, NSW. Under new management, this culinary gem has quickly garnered praise for its enticing menu and warm, welcoming atmosphere. Guests rave about the delicious dumplings and substantial portions, showcasing both quality and value.
If you’re hunting for affordable yet top-notch comfort food, E-Dragon Dumplings Bar stands out as a delightful option. Don't miss the chance to experience this local treasure!